在羽毛球场地上,一群人拿着"大号乒乓球拍",打一颗镂空塑料球。这个乍一看"四不像"的运动,就是今年让无数人一玩就上头的新宠——匹克球。 时至今日,匹克球已经是一项在国际上有很高知名度和众多参与者的运动项目。2024年,匹克球也成为巴黎奥运会上的表演项目。而在国内,匹克球则是 近十年才开始流行的。 匹克球的玩法很简单:在一个羽毛球场大小的区域内,双方隔着球网,使用类似大号乒乓球拍的实心球拍,来回击打一个布满圆孔的塑料球。因此人们形 容它像是"用乒乓球拍,在羽毛球场上打网球"。 当羽毛球、网球等经典运动越来越"烧钱",简单、好玩、社交性强的匹克球,成为异军突起的"亲民运动"。很多羽毛球馆都开始降网、画线,把场地改为 匹克球场,试图赶上这场热潮。不仅仅是北上广,在三四线城市甚至是县城,匹克球的热度同样很高。 这让人上头的运动,到底好玩在哪里? 01 "缝合怪"匹克球,其实不是新运动 如今代表着潮流和时尚的匹克球,实际上是一项被翻红的运动。 它诞生于1965年一个普通的周末,美国国会议员Joel Pritchard和朋友Bill Bell在班布里奇岛度假,孩子们抱怨无事可做,他们便想着如何用手边的运动器械 自创一项强 ...

Core Viewpoint - The rise of pickleball in Shangyou County, Jiangxi, is attributed to its low entry barrier, suitability for all ages, and potential for community engagement and economic development [6][9]. Group 1: Pickleball Characteristics - Pickleball is described as a hybrid sport combining elements of badminton, table tennis, and tennis, played on a smaller court with a slower ball speed, making it accessible for various age groups [4][7]. - The sport can be played in doubles, allowing for social interaction while playing, which enhances its appeal [4]. Group 2: Local Development and Promotion - In 2023, local officials recognized the potential of pickleball for community fitness and decided to promote it as a key sports industry initiative, leading to a comprehensive development plan [6]. - Over 50,000 people have engaged in pickleball activities in Shangyou, indicating its popularity and community integration [7]. Group 3: Infrastructure and Accessibility - The county has constructed over 310 pickleball courts, ensuring that residents have access to facilities within a five-minute walking distance [8]. - The largest ecological pickleball center was developed from previously unused land, showcasing a blend of sports and environmental aesthetics [8]. Group 4: Educational and Competitive Initiatives - Pickleball has been incorporated into the physical education curriculum of 36 local schools, with over 100 teams formed and more than 50 competitions held [11]. - The county has invested 10 million yuan annually to support the development of the pickleball industry, including training and events [11]. Group 5: Economic Impact and Industry Growth - The growth of pickleball has stimulated related industries, with local manufacturers innovating new materials for equipment, leveraging regional advantages [13]. - The integration of pickleball with local tourism, such as "pickleball + rafting" packages, has contributed to significant tourism revenue, with over 10.66 million visitors and 10.78 billion yuan in income reported in 2025 [15].

Core Viewpoint - Pickleball is gaining popularity but faces challenges in becoming a mainstream sport, particularly in China, where it is still considered a niche activity [6][30]. Group 1: Popularity and Perception - Pickleball was designed to lower the intensity of play, making it more accessible, but this has led to a perception of it being less prestigious compared to tennis and badminton [9][10]. - Despite its growing presence on social media, pickleball lacks the viral potential seen in other sports, with limited engagement from celebrities and influencers [11][13]. - In the U.S., pickleball has seen a dramatic increase in players, growing from under 5 million in 2021 to over 50 million in just two years, indicating a significant trend [14][19]. Group 2: Market Dynamics - The global pickleball equipment market is projected to grow from $1.61 billion in 2024 to $3.1 billion by 2032,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.3% [19]. - The establishment of professional leagues like the UPA in the U.S. has contributed to the sport's commercialization and increased visibility [21][22]. - In China, the first pickleball court was built in 2010, but the sport is still in its early stages of development, primarily driven by returning expatriates [15][20]. Group 3: Challenges in China - The current infrastructure for pickleball in China is limited, with fewer than 100 dedicated courts in Beijing, many of which are repurposed from other sports [27]. - The perception of pickleball as a "low-end" sport may hinder its growth among younger demographics, who may prefer more intense or competitive sports [30][36]. - While there is potential for growth, the transition from casual play to regular participation remains a challenge, with many players uncertain about committing long-term [37].

Core Viewpoint - Taihe New Materials (002254) is indirectly involved in the production of pickleball paddles through design, brand operation, and product OEM, rather than direct manufacturing [1] Group 1: Raw Material Involvement - The company produces aramid fiber and its subsidiary, Minshida, manufactures aramid paper for honeycomb applications, which are used in the high-end pickleball paddles [1] - Orders have been delivered in bulk, with customer feedback indicating performance exceeding expectations [1] - The company is in discussions with multiple domestic sports brands for collaboration [1] Group 2: Brand Development - Minshida has completed trademark registration and patent applications for the pickleball brand "Aivita" [1] - The company has established partnerships with several universities and clubs, resulting in sales [1]
